Why Window Replacements Are Increasingly Popular

Glass-Replacement-150x150.jpgWindow replacements make a home more comfortable by eliminating drafts and reducing the strain on the air conditioner or furnace. They also add aesthetics and increase the value of a home.

If your windows are becoming damaged or difficult to open and close, it's time to consider replacements. The proper window design can increase energy efficiency, improve the curb appeal, and make maintenance a breeze.

Energy Efficiency

In a growing number of cases, people are becoming aware of the effects the energy consumption of their homes affects their home's operational efficiency. As a result, some people choose to purchase new windows to reduce the energy use of their homes.

It is no surprise that replacing old windows can help reduce your energy costs and make your home more eco sustainable.

Replacing older windows with more efficient models can save you up to 25% off your heating and cooling expenses depending on your geographical location and the kind of window you select. Energy efficient windows contain multiple glass panes, separated by gas insulation or other materials They have special coatings that help reflect sunlight and heat. Certain windows are soundproof which is a wonderful feature for homeowners who live in busy areas.

The cost of replacing your windows with more efficient ones can be expensive but the government can provide rebates and tax credits to offset these initial expenses. If you stay with a reliable window installation service that is renowned for their high-quality products and excellent customer service, you will be able to find low-cost alternatives to increase your home's energy efficiency.

They will last longer and require less maintenance. This can be an important selling aspect for your home should you ever decide to sell it. Additionally, many of the energy efficient window models available today have a low moisture transfer rate, which means that they will not promote mildew growth as much as traditional windows.

It is crucial to remember that, even though energy efficient Windows are more durable than other windows, they're not impervious to damage. It is recommended that your windows be regularly checked by professionals to ensure they are functioning correctly. Also, while you can install your new windows by yourself, it's an undertaking that requires specific tools and knowledge of window installation techniques to be completed successfully.

Durability

If you're thinking of replacing a window it is important to think about the durability of each option. Windows that are durable will shield your home from the elements, extreme temperatures and burglary. You'll save 7% to 15 percent on energy costs.

The type of material used for the frame and glass plays an important part in the overall durability of the window. Vinyl frames are the most sought-after but they can warp or break over time. Fiberglass frames are more durable and come in a range of colors that coordinate with your paint and trim.

Take into consideration the energy efficiency too. Some options include insulating gases such as argon and Krypton, which are added to the glass window replacements near Me panes. This can help prevent cold or heat from escaping. While these options are beneficial in reducing your energy bill, they can be costly to replace if they fail or lose their effectiveness over time.

Installing replacement windows during the cooler seasons is a great way to increase the lifespan of your windows. This will minimize the amount of work required in harsh weather conditions which could affect the tolerances required for caulking and other finishing touches. This may not be possible however, if live in an area with extreme conditions for climate.

The process of installation will also impact the longevity of the replacement windows. The most important step is taking precise measurements. If you don't take care you could end up with replacements that are way too big for the openings they are. You'll have to pay for an additional restocking fee or replace them using shims while you wait to get the proper size replacements.

If you'd like to avoid these issues get a professional to assist you with the installation. Professionals will make the right measurements and utilize the appropriate tools to ensure that your new windows are properly fitted. Additionally, they have access to the top quality windows available. If you're looking for a contractor on your project, make sure they have extensive experience and are insured and licensed.

Visual Appeal

Windows make up a large part of the exterior of your home, and they can greatly influence the overall appearance of your home. Old, outdated windows can look tired and lackluster and stylish, new windows will give your home a modern and modern look. Modern, sleek frames make it easier than ever to find replacement windows that match your aesthetic.

You can sell your home faster and at a higher value by enhancing your curb appeal. Many people try to boost their home's curb appeal by mowing their lawns and planting attractive flowers and shrubs, and painting the house when necessary. However, this isn't always enough to get the desired results. The problem is usually in the windows, which can be damaged or discolored as time passes.

New windows can improve the interior of your house by letting more sunlight into the space and allowing uninterrupted views of the cityscape and landscape. This can lighten your rooms and make them more inviting. Furthermore, modern windows are designed to provide an environment that is safe for living. For example tempering glass breaks down into smaller pieces rather than sharp and jagged shards once broken. Additionally, laminated glass has an interlayer of polymer that provides increased durability and better protection against intruders.

Upgrading your windows can also help lower your energy costs and noise levels which makes your home more relaxing and comfortable. If your windows are showing signs of wear, like cracked frames or glass, it could be time to replace them.

Window replacements can be an excellent investment for your home as they can increase its resale value and improve the overall functionality and energy efficiency. Additionally, they come in a wide range of styles and colors so you can pick the one that best suits your needs and preferences.

Maintenance

It's time for you to replace old windows when they begin to begin to show signs of being worn out. Replacement of old windows with modern models can add beauty to your home, make it more comfortable and improve its value for resales.

Window replacements can also provide significant energy savings and require much less maintenance than older windows glasses replacement. They are available in a wide variety of styles and materials to match your preferences as well as your home's architectural style. Wood is ideal for homes located in historic districts that must conform to particular design standards, while aluminum offers an easy-to-maintain option.

You'll find that today's windows are built to last. Many windows feature formed fins that seal out rain, snow and air. Some are filled with special gas like the argon, krypton or to improve the efficiency of thermal heating.

If you decide to go with a full-frame replacement or an insert installation, both can help enhance your home's beauty and increase its resale value. If you plan to sell your house in the near future, replacing the windows can also improve the appearance. This will allow prospective buyers to envision their belongings and themselves living in the space.

A major undertaking like window replacement requires a large financial investment. Homeowners who are smart know that window replacements are worth the cost for the benefits of reduced cost of energy and an increase in value.

It's time to replace your windows if they are leaking or are difficult to close or open or exhibit other signs of wear. Newer windows are more efficient in terms of energy efficiency, have superior sound insulation and are more durable than older models.

Talk to your local Marvin professional when you're thinking of replacing your windows to determine the most effective method of installation for your home. Full-frame replacement requires removing all existing frames and windows to expose the rough opening. This permits installers to fix problems like water damage and rot within the frame of the window. This kind of installation can also be used to change the shape or size of a window opening.
